Recording startup trigger
A recording startup trigger is used to start data accumulation, and satisfied when a specified device
(Page 40 Operating status)
*1 For devices that can be specified, refer to the following:
Page 29 Devices that can be specified as triggers
*2 Whether a trigger has been satisfied is determined during the END processing in a scan of a CPU module.
Precautions
• Start the recording function and check that its operating status switches to 'operating,' then satisfy a recording startup
trigger. The operating status can be checked in 'In recording operation' of a recorder module. (Page 104 Recording
status area (Un\G1500 to 3199))
• If a recording startup trigger is satisfied again after it is satisfied and data is accumulated, the accumulated data is
discarded and the accumulation restarts.
■Period during which a recording startup trigger is enabled or disabled
A recording startup trigger is enabled except the period from when a file saving trigger is satisfied to when saving a recording
file is completed.
